I have started noticing tar marks on my Compass lately. Very tiny black dot marks on all 4 doors. It was not bothering me until the last few months, they were more and more marks. No matter how much shampoo I used, they were not going away.

I bought this Tar and Bugs removal spray on Amazon after doing some research. It cost me some 450 bucks. The results were good, I wouldn't say it worked 100%, but it was able to remove 80-85% of the Tar marks. Maybe regular usage will give better results.

I followed the below steps after reading the instructions on the can.

  • Wiped all doors clean with a damp microfiber cloth
  • Let it dry for few minutes
  • Sprayed generous amount of spray on all 4 doors
  • Let it sit for 40-60 seconds
  • Wiped off the spray
  • Repeat again on places where the tar is still stuck

Happy with the overall results.
